The cost of green hydrogen in India could fall by up to 40%, reaching between Rs 260 and Rs 310 per kilogram, driven by government incentives, affordable renewable electricity, and tax reductions
For green hydrogen, the government has set incentives for production at Rs 50 per kg in the first year, Rs 40 in the second year, and Rs 30 in the third year, totaling Rs 5400 crore

only 41% of projects awarded by SECI during fiscals 2018-21 got commissioned till December 2022. 23% were cancelled and the balance was delayed on account of issues in land acquisition, and evacuation and supply-side constraints.
